I am a new agent in Texas trying to get started. I am working in the Medicare Advantage and PDP market. My FMO has done some training on grass roots marketing but so far hasn't yielded any appointments.

How is the best way to start getting appointments?
By the way, I just got Burned for $860 dollars using Sales-Associate Pre-set appointments. Bought 20 appointments, got 0. Will not return my calls, letters, or emails.

What is the best ay for somebody brand new to start getting appointments? I don't have any referrals to fall back on.

It all depends on your marketing budget. If you got at least $465-$500 a week, talk to someone on here drops a lot of direct mail.

If you're broke, ditch MA, PDP for a while, get some med sup contracts, a dialer, and some training...then start calling areas outside of MA populated areas. Get licensed in multiple states if you have to.

Get to 150 clients as fast as you can, and when the renewals start kicking in, start your MA marketing.

And in the meantime, find other ways to sell MA compliantly without spending a lot of money.
 
Try setting tables at community events where there will be seniors, farmers market, flea market, health fairs.
